Q: Is the packaging in-store recyclable?
A: Thank you for your interest in the sustainability of Sargento® product packaging. We appreciate the chance to share our progress toward environmental responsibility. The Outer Bags for Snack Stick, String, and Cube Cheese are recyclable through in-store drop-off programs. Some materials are currently not recyclable, including the snack stick inner wrappers. We’re actively researching alternatives that meet food safety standards while improving recyclability. Sargento is committed to reducing our environmental impact. All our packaging is BPA-free and polycarbonate-free. Thank you for supporting our journey toward more sustainable packaging.

Q: What is the source of the enzymes on the string cheese?
A: Hello! Most Sargento® natural cheeses are made with non-animal rennet. Rennet refers to the enzymes added to milk when making cheese to thicken the mixture to form the curds. Microbial rennet is derived from the fermentation process of certain “good” bacteria. The Sargento® natural cheeses that may contain animal enzymes are those generally considered traditional Italian cheese styles such as Romano, Provolone, Asiago, and Fontina. Those cheese varieties are found in our Italian blends, sliced Provolone, and potentially any product with this cheese type listed. All other Sargento® cheeses contain non-animal enzymes. None of our Natural Cheese products contain pork enzymes.

Q: Is this cheese pasteurized?
A: Thank you for your question. The milk used to make all Sargento® cheeses is pasteurized.
